Understanding RTP and Betting Ranges
The Return to Player (RTP) percentage is approximately 98%, which is a highly attractive figure within the online gaming world. This means that, on average, the game pays back 98% of all wagered money to players over a prolonged period. While not a guaranteed win, a higher RTP indicates a fairer game from the player’s perspective. The betting range adds to the flexibility of the game. You can stake as little as $0.01 or up to $200 per round, accommodating both casual players and those hoping for larger payouts.

Auto Cashout Functionality
Many platforms hosting the chicken road game offer an auto-cashout feature, allowing you to set a desired multiplier target. When the multiplier reaches that target, your bet is automatically cashed out, ensuring you capture your winnings, even if you’re distracted or the network connection drops. This feature can be incredibly valuable, especially for players who are new to the game or prefer a more hands-off approach. It automates risk management and removes the emotional element of timing the cashout, leading to more rational decisions.
However, it’s crucial to set your auto-cashout target strategically. Too low, and you might be leaving money on the table. Too high, and you risk losing your stake to a sudden crash. Finding the sweet spot requires experimentation and a good understanding of the game mechanics.
Bankroll Management Techniques
Effective bankroll management is arguably the most crucial aspect of playing the chicken road game. Setting a budget and sticking to it is paramount. Never bet more than you can afford to lose, and avoid chasing losses. A common rule of thumb is to allocate a percentage of your bankroll to each bet—typically between 1% and 5%. This prevents catastrophic losses and ensures you have sufficient funds to weather losing streaks. Remember, gambling should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a get-rich-quick scheme.
- Set a daily or weekly spending limit.
- Don’t chase losses by increasing your bets.
- Withdraw winnings regularly to secure profits.
- Avoid betting emotionally; base decisions on strategy.
